Hearts of Oak goalkeeper Richmond Ayi says his teammate Benjamin Afutu was the best player in the suspended 2019/20 Ghana Premier League.

The Premier League has been on hold since March 15 following a ban on all public gatherings, including sporting and religious events due to the coronavirus crisis.

Players such as Aduana Stars striker Yahaya Mohammed and Inter Allies' Victorien Adebayor were the toast of advocates of the top-flight league due to their incessant goalscoring exploits.

But Ayi believes his teammate was miles ahead of every player in the league.

"Benjamin Afutu is the player that should be awarded if the league is to be restarted for a new season looking at his contribution for us (Hearts of Oak), he was all over before the league was halted," Ayi told Wontumi FM.

"Although Yahaya, Victorien and some crop of players were scoring BUT for a striker to score it must come from the back before it can reach to them."
